Bitcoin Explorer
This Bitcoin blockchain explorer, which you can host yourself, utilizes RPC calls to connect to your own Bitcoin node, making the setup process easy and allowing for compatibility with various additional tools, like Electrum servers, to enrich your exploration experience. Whether your reasons for running a full node are to encourage trustlessness, satisfy a technical curiosity, or contribute to the Bitcoin ecosystem, it is crucial to grasp the extensive features that your node provides. With this explorer, you can investigate not only the blockchain data but also the numerous functions available within your node. You can obtain in-depth insights into blocks, transactions, and addresses, while employing analytical tools to evaluate statistics regarding block activity, transaction volumes, and mining efficiency. Furthermore, you can access the raw JSON data from bitcoind, which forms the basis for much of the interface. The search feature enables you to find transaction IDs, block hashes or heights, and specific addresses with ease. You can also query Electrum-protocol servers for transaction histories associated with particular addresses, and a summary of the mempool is presented, detailing fees, sizes, and ages for pending transactions.
